 In a landmark effort to preserve their heritage against cultural assimilation, over 300 Tibetan students, teachers, and parents gathered in New York for the first-ever North American Tibetan Weekend Schools arts and literary competition. Organized to celebrate the global "Year of Compassion," the marathon event featured ten schools competing in debate, elocution, singing, and dancing. The competition highlighted a powerful commitment to keeping the Tibetan language and identity alive in the diaspora. Northern California’s Namchoe Kyeltsal School took first place overall. Leaders praised the youth's dedication, viewing it as a vital defense of their cultural legacy.
